Xserver/dix/atom.c (et al.): Constify atom name strings.

Inspired by X.org commits: commit 08093c25a91c07ab8af7cece9bba738b827cfd1b Author: Alan Coopersmith <alan.coopersmith@oracle.com> Date: Mon Oct 24 23:16:30 2011 -0700 Convert some malloc + strncpy pairs into strndup calls Signed-off-by: 's avatarAlan Coopersmith <alan.coopersmith@oracle.com> Reviewed-by: 's avatarJeremy Huddleston <jeremyhu@apple.com> commit 816b79dd061e9839cec94a4986a7820b70ca8a7f Author: Mikhail Gusarov <dottedmag@dottedmag.net> Date: Thu May 13 03:45:21 2010 +0700 Remove useless casts Signed-off-by: 's avatarMikhail Gusarov <dottedmag@dottedmag.net> Reviewed-by: 's avatarKeith Packard <keithp@keithp.com> This PR ships a tiny change in MakeAtom, that we adopted. We did not adopt the full commit. commit 5623c27700b7b23a8dbbd8c8f45e5d4fa0c667e3 Author: Alan Coopersmith <alan.coopersmith@sun.com> Date: Mon Feb 2 19:25:14 2009 -0800 Constify atom name strings Changes MakeAtom to take a const char * and NameForAtom to return them, since many callers pass pointers to constant strings stored in read-only ELF sections. Updates in-tree callers as necessary to clear const mismatch warnings introduced by this change.
